well the JBP cams do work, but the car would definetly benifit from some tuneing, I'm also upgrading my valve springs and retainers so that I'll be safe with a higher redline, not that I have the cams.
supossidly all internals are ok up to 300HP then the first to change will be the pistons to something forged , then the valve springs.
but JBP does also offer new connecting rods for those who are really looking to get up there interms of power.
so right know your looking at:
complete valvetrain upgrade (only at JBP some valve springs and retainers from some vendors)
Forged pistons (Diamond or GM)
connecting rods (JBP)
cams (JBP & crane or comp cams is still working on it)
no direct supercharger swap yet
twincharger ( soon to come)
